Title reads: "Calais - Lydd".

Calais, France to Lydd, Kent.

Air News - Bleriot replica flies the Channel. C/U Jean Salis standing beside his replica of Bleriot's plane, waving before taking off from France to fly to England in the air race. Camera pans to the engine of the plane. Pan...
